Transaction 528d9ea96f806b3f890cf7c5e90319075242046320d2784c2c5f01b8cf6fce9e

6 Input
1 Outputs
  • 528d9ea96f806b3f890cf7c5e90319075242046320d2784c2c5f01b8cf6fce9e:0
  • value  53657693
    address  3NKqkpp2LH1fovE16dCZWizfSSzoEdRJrZ